The Analog Cub Posted August 25, 2015 Share Posted August 25, 2015 Just started my last first day of school yesterday. Senior year in Software Engineering at Iowa State (Go Cyclones!) 15 credits, so five 3-credit classes, which is normal full load. Senior Design Project - Class is shared with Computer Engineers and Electrical Engineers. The list of projects created by people in the industry was given out today, so now I'm narrowing it down to projects that want SE's. Double edged sword in that it's easier to pick from now, but also less choices. I can't do embedded systems or hardware or shit like that. Just software development and codey goodness for me. Operating Systems - This one will be about as fun as I'm willing to make it, it looks like. A few programming projects in C, so I can try to make it interesting. It won't be the worst class in the world. Software Project Management - LOL. Here we go. This class is notorious for being an easy A with busy work. But it's required. The general consensus for this one is that you don't really learn anything applicable to PM in this class. You'll learn anything you need to know in the actual industry. Probability/Stats for Computer Science - The mathy homework heavy class of the semester that will guarantee much dozing off or browsing the Internet in lecture while also filling up 2 notebooks of example problems. This might not be hard, but it will suck. Algorithm Analysis - Ged help us all. The token hard class of the semester. Lots of computer science theory (which I despise) with proofs and shit, and some nasty Java programming somewhere in there.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
